Solvent-centered extraction features the usage of aprotic natural solvents like hexane, tetrahydrofuran, and acetone for the extraction of β-carotene from algae write-up- and pre-cure. These extraction solvents are helpful with the extraction of β-carotene from algae, fungi, and vegetation (Chen et al. 2021). Supercritical fluids lessen the extraction time of β-carotene together with enhance the effectiveness of extraction. Atmospheric liquid extraction with the assistance of maceration is utilized for extraction functions without the usage of innovative devices and is simple to perform. Soxhlet extraction is far less complicated and most generally utilized for the Matrine extraction of carotenoids such as β-carotene. This process offers the very best Restoration prices and would not demand sophisticated instruments. This process utilizes massive quantities of solvents along with the starter content for extraction purposes which makes the extraction technique highly high-priced (Saini and Keum 2018).

Summary Astragalus membranaceus Bunge is greatly Utilized in Classic Chinese Medication to treat various cancers. Astragaloside‑IV (AS‑IV) is one of the major compounds isolated from the. membranaceus Bunge and has actually been demonstrated to get antitumor effects by inhibiting mobile proliferation, invasion and metastasis in various most cancers forms. Quite a few reports have used in vitro mobile culture As well as in vivo animal types of cancer to explore the antitumor things to do of AS‑IV. From the present analyze, the antitumor outcomes and mechanisms of AS‑IV claimed in scientific tests recorded while in the PubMed databases have been reviewed. Initial, the antitumor consequences of AS‑IV on proliferation, cell cycle, apoptosis, autophagy, invasion, migration, metastasis and epithelial‑mesenchymal transition procedures in cancer cells as well as tumor microenvironment, like angiogenesis, tumor immunity and macrophage‑connected immune responses to most cancers cells, were comprehensively reviewed. Subsequently, the molecular mechanisms and connected signaling pathways associated with antitumor results of AS‑IV as indicated by in vitro As well as in vivo research ended up summarized, such as the Wnt/AKT/GSK-3β (glycogen synthase kinase‑3β)/β‑catenin, TGF‑β/PI3K/AKT/mTOR, PI3K/MAPK/mTOR, PI3K/AKT/NF‑κB, Rac family compact GTPase 1/RAS/MAPK/ERK, TNF‑α/protein kinase C/ERK1/2‑NF‑κB and Tregs (T‑regulatory cells)/IL‑11/STAT3 signaling pathways.
